From Bugzilla Helper: User-Agent: Mozilla/5.0 (X11; U; Linux i686; rv:1.7.3) Gecko/20041002 Firefox/0.10.1 Description of problem: 1. Use Nautilus (browser mode) to open a directory on an FTP server. 2. Create a folder. 3. Right-click and choose Rename. 4. Name it with a number (say, 2004). There is a pause, and then the operation appears to fail. Refreshing doesn't help. Nautilus appears to display the result of an ls -l command instead of an actual name, and one cannot open the directory. (The rename operation actually succeeds, so it looks like the problem is in displaying the directory.)
